What is the difference between Procurement Agent Two vs Procurement Agent One?

AspectProcurement Agent TwoProcurement Agent One
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certifications like CPSMHigh school diploma; entry-level position, less emphasis on certifications
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, procurement departments, sometimes on-site at supplier locationsOffice-based, supporting procurement activities
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, government, and corporate sectorsUsed across similar industries, often as an entry-level role
Search & Comparison IntentLooking for roles with more responsibilities and experienceEntry-level procurement support roles

Procurement Agent Two typically requires more experience and certifications than Procurement Agent One, handling more complex procurement tasks. While both roles operate in similar environments and industries, Procurement Agent Two is suited for those with a few years of experience seeking advancement, whereas Procurement Agent One is ideal for entry-level candidates.

Is procurement agent two a stressful job?

Procurement agent two roles can involve pressure to meet deadlines, manage supplier relationships, and control costs, which may contribute to stress. The level of stress varies depending on workload, organizational environment, and experience, but strong organizational and communication skills can help manage job demands.

Job description

Under the general direction of a Senior Manager, the Procurement Agent/Senior Procurement Agent plays a vital role in managing procurement and contractual projects for a diverse range of commodities, professional services, management and maintenance services, concessions, construction, and information technology software. This position involves the development of solicitation documents, as well as the execution of procurements through various methods. This role will review and process requisitions, purchase orders, and purchasing card payments while analyzing contract terms and conditions to effectively handle change orders, amendments, and renewals. Additionally, this position will analyze cost proposals and financial data to prepare detailed management reports and project-related Board documents, ensuring compliance and strategic alignment with organizational objectives. This role is crucial for optimizing procurement processes and fostering strong supplier relationships.
The selected applicant will be brought in as a Procurement Agent or a Senior Procurement Agent based on education, experience, and certifications.
SUPERVISES OTHERS: NO
FLSA STATUS: EXEMPT
COMPENSATION: $70,000 - $85,000 -based on experience
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
  • Experience negotiating contract terms, managing change orders, and processing requisitions and purchase orders.
  • Experience coordinating the solicitation evaluation process and preparing project-related documents for Board approval.
  • Perform procurements for goods and services using sole source, government cooperative contracts, and solicitations such as ITB, RA, RFP, ITN, and RFQ.
  • Develop and create contracts and solicitation documents for ITB, RA, RFP, ITN, and RFQ processes. Review and process requisitions, purchase orders, and purchasing card payments efficiently.
  • Analyze contract terms and conditions and develop and process change orders, amendments, and renewals as necessary.
  • Utilize contract administration software programs and ERP systems to manage procurement activities.
  • Negotiate contract terms, including insurance and surety requirements, to ensure favorable outcomes. Analyze cost proposals and financial data, preparing detailed management reports for decision-making.
  • Prepare project-related documents for Board review and approval.
  • Obtain and analyze informal written quotes to support procurement decisions.
  • Perform in-depth research and document development to procure goods and services through sole source, government cooperative contracts, and competitive solicitations such as ITB, RA, RFP, ITN, and RFQ.
  • Analyze cost proposals and financial data, preparing detailed management reports to inform decision-making.
  • Develop complex contracts and solicitation documents (ITB, RA, RFP, ITN, RFQ) and coordinate their approval through the Governing Board.
  • Negotiate contract terms, insurance, and surety requirements to ensure favorable agreements for the organization.
  • Analyze contract terms and conditions, developing and processing change orders, amendments, and renewals as necessary.
  • Review and process requisitions, purchase orders, and purchasing card payments to maintain efficient procurement operations.
  • Utilize contract administration software and ERP systems to streamline procurement processes and enhance data management.
  • Prepare project-related documents for Board review and approval, ensuring compliance with organizational policies.

QUALIFICATIONS (E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E, LICENSES & CERTIFICATIONS):
Procurement Agent
  • Associate's Degree in Business Administration, or higher in Management, Public Administration, or a related field
  • Two (2) years of experience in contract and procurement document development, including but not limited to document development, contract writing and management, and knowledge of governmental relations, processes, research techniques, etc.
  • Or equivalent combination of education, training, and experience that would reasonably be expected to provide the job-related competencies noted below.
  • Certified Professional Public Buyer (CPPB) or Certified Public Procurement Officer (CPPO) within 18 months of hire
  • Must possess a valid, current Florida Driver's License at the level required for the position when operating an Authority vehicle or driving on behalf of the Authority.

Senior Procurement Agent
  • Bachelor's Degree in Business Administration, or higher in Management, Public Administration, or a related field
  • Three (3) years of experience in formal contract and procurement document development, including but not limited to document development, contract writing and management, and knowledge of governmental relations, processes, research techniques, etc.
  • Or equivalent combination of education, training, and experience that would reasonably be expected to provide the job-related competencies noted below.
  • Certified Professional Public Buyer (CPPB) or Certified Public Procurement Officer (CPPO) required at time of hire
  • NIGP Certified Procurement Professional (NIGP-CPP) certification within 18 months of hire.
  • Must possess a valid, current Florida Driver's License at the level required for the position when operating an Authority vehicle or driving on behalf of the Authority.
